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70 79610197788 5776527685 4697
28108450402 810978698
28108450402 810978698
953066 237898670 48
All about undefined
Interested in learning more?
28108450402 810978698
953066 237898670 48
See more
1956749168 039919 97591
97 4523032 5673
See more
55 41617797
9714250 26635470 491 99 25979205
See more